I have every kind of American scotch still being made by American Snuff Co., U.S. Smokeless and Swisher. I’ve really tried to find things to like about each one, and I’ve tried to learn to tell them apart. I’ve come to love most of them. Starr is great because of its absolute plainness. Square is wonderful and a bit different because it’s darker and coarser than the others. Three Thistle is surprisingly smooth and easy to snuff. Superior is also a treat for the nose. Navy plain has a nice cocoa scent, similar to Carhart’s etc. but without all the sugar. Try as I might, though, I just can’t find anything to love about Standard. It’s very fine so consequently very difficult to avoid it hitting the throat, and the flavour is dusty and inferior. Maybe I just got a stale tin, but I doubt it–I bought it from Nicotine Rush and all their snuffs tended to be as fresh as possible. If we had to vote one off the island, my vote would definitely go to Standard.

I’ll be contrary and say Rooster is my favorite. Then, I don’t use it straight either, but as a mixer due to its incredible potency. I also don’t have problems with it hitting the back of my throat since I mix this stuff with English snuffs. To me, Rooster mixes particularly well with apricot, apple, and peach snuffs–a regular mixture for me. I can’t use any of the scotches straight. When I do I find my bronchial tubes in my chest get irritated, which means the snuff is going down farther than it is supposed to. I’ve never had this problem with any other type of snuff.
